Raised in a family of successful international entrepreneurs, Sergio Torres has watched thriving businesses grow with his own eyes. However, for the 31-year-old Santa Clarita man who is launching Brightway, The Torres Agency insurance office next week, it’s not just about dollars and cents. It’s about a family who has paid a price. From their freedom to their very own lives, Torres’ family knows the true cost of success.

Torres’ new Brightway franchise opening Monday is a long way from where he was just two decades ago. The new Southern California business owner is more than 3,000 miles away from where his family fled in 2006. A teenage boy at the time, Torres and his family were among the thousands fleeing the Central American nation of El Salvador. More than 200,000 Salvadorans flee their homes each year in fear of violence and crime. More than six million people still live within the borders of El Salvador.

“My grandparents owned and operated a chain of grocery stores there. However, with the success they enjoyed came tragedy, as well,” Torres said. “Being associated with a successful business, my grandmother was taken hostage for ransom when I was just nine years old.” Torres’ grandmother would become one of the unthinkable statistics that take place all too regularly in the small nation ravaged by a civil war that has raged on for decades. Kidnappers eventually took his grandmother’s life. Just a few months later, his grandfather would pass away, as well. “He truly died of a broken heart. When we later moved to the states, it was to give our family hope for the future. It changed us forever.”

As his father still owns a plastics manufacturer back in El Salvador, Torres has had opportunities to join the family business. However, after his childhood in Central America, he felt a calling to help others in distress. Earning a Bachelor of Science in Criminal Justice from California Lutheran University, Torres would find himself across the country serving and protecting a Midwest town. “I was attracted to the crime shows on television. I wanted to be an FBI agent,” Torres said of his time with the Bloomington (MN) Police Department. “However, after a few years on the force, I really had the desire to go into business back home and build on the family legacy.”

Like more than 43 percent of Californians, Torres is bilingual. His passion to run his own business and directly serve the Hispanic community in Northern Los Angeles County helped give birth to this new venture.

“I’ve had opportunities to return to El Salvador and run a business,” Torres said. “But this American dream is something my family hoped for when it came to the kids. And with so many moving here from Central and South America, I am excited to find ways to directly help protect them and their families.”

Torres is just beginning a family of his own with the recent engagement to his fiancé, Karly. They are expecting their daughter, Sofia Grace, in February.

About Brightway Insurance

Established in 2008, Brightway grew to become one of the largest privately-owned property/casualty insurance distribution companies in the U.S. with more than 300 franchises in 30 states and over $900 million in annual premiums. Recently, Brightway’s success led to a private equity investment that has infused the company with financial and human capital, and data and analytics access, to accelerate growth and deliver new and exciting market opportunities.
